Helly Hansen (HH) is a Norwegian manufacturer and retailer of clothing and sports equipment, owned by the American clothing company Kontoor Brands and operated as a subsidiary. Currently headquartered in Oslo, it was previously headquartered in Moss, Norway, from its founding in 1877 until October 2009.
